网络技术优化,提升学习体验

单片机内置页面设计软件(单片机做界面)

页面设计 2025-05-09 浏览(103) 评论(0)
- N +

文章目录[+]

STM32单片机实战项目:基于TouchGFX的智能手表设计(7)Designer软件UI设计...

1、在TouchGFX资产文件夹下增加UI界面图标,并分别在APPPage、Container和DialPage文件夹下组织组件。在Designer软件中,通过点击左侧的Add Screen右侧的+号添加屏幕显示区,双击新建的screen修改名字为DialPage和ApplicationPage。

2、在UI启动时,仅需12kB的RAM(缓存 + TouchGFX),适用于所有STM32系列,包括Cortex M0+内核。Touch GFX允许开发者自定义屏幕大小,与STM32CubeMX结合使用,可快速搭建完整的开发环境,实现高效开发。其支持的主要LCD接口包括RGB TFT、DSI、FMC LCD和SPI LCD,满足了硬件设计的需求。

3、TouchGFX Designer软件介绍 基础控件与交互设计讲解 在线帮助指引与图形引擎介绍 实验部分:用TouchGFX Designer或STM32H750-DK开发板完成界面设计。实验平台:基于TouchGFX Designer 20,结合模板包进行开发,使用STM32H750-DK测试图形效果。

4、通过CubeMX创建基本工程,配置外设,如添加触摸屏支持。生成代码,导入至STM32 CubeIDE,并测试运行项目。为项目添加TouchGFX软件包(2步)将TouchGFX软件包添加至项目,并配置基本参数,如显示接口、颜色格式、帧缓存策略等。设计界面 使用TouchGFX Designer添加控件,生成代码,使界面在LCD上显示。

嵌入式、单片机开发必备软件有哪些?

1、WGestures - 这是一款免费且开源的国产鼠标手势软件,能够作用于几乎所有的Windows程序,支持执行各种操作,如前进、后退、关闭窗口、最大化、最小化、复制、粘贴等。通过手势控制,WGestures实现了单手操作的高效性,提升了用户体验。

2、Keil 是业界最受欢迎的51单片机开发工具之一,它拥有流畅的用户界面与强大的仿真功能。 RealView MDK 开发工具源自德国Keil公司,被全球超过10万的嵌入式开发工程师验证和使用,是arm 公司目前最新推出的针对各种嵌入式处理器的软件开发工具。

3、BowPad:一款轻量级的文本编辑器,适用于编写少量代码或查看日志。 Keil:单片机开发IDE,适合学习单片机的初学者。 VSCode:由微软开发的跨平台源代码编辑器,支持语法高亮、代码自动补全、代码重构等功能。在Ubuntu中进行嵌入式开发时,VSCode是很好的选择。

ProteusPro电路仿真软件V90免费版ProteusPro电路仿真软件V90免费版功能...

Logicly(模拟电路仿真软件) V6 破解版:Logicly是一款非常好用的电路模拟仿真软件单片机内置页面设计软件,此软件可以帮助想要进行电路学习的用户更加快速的上手单片机内置页面设计软件,界面非常直观单片机内置页面设计软件,需要设计电路所需的所有组件单片机内置页面设计软件,它也可以运行完成的电路设计,检查是否正常,并支持取消错误的操作。

安装软件:首先,确保已经安装了Keil编程软件和Proteus仿真软件。获取电路图:可以打开已有的YL51电路图,或者根据需要自行创建电路图。编写程序代码:在Keil中编写单片机的程序代码,并生成HEX文件。这个文件将用于在Proteus中进行仿真。设置Proteus仿真电路:打开Proteus,并导入或创建好电路原理图。

keyshot9破解版是一款功能强大的3D渲染软件,它可以帮助用户进行实时渲染并输出渲染后的内容,此版本增加了全新的降噪功能,可在CPU和GPU模式下使用,以消除实时视图和渲染输出中的噪声,可谓是用户进行渲染的最佳选择。

功能定位:Protel99SE主要是一款用于电路板设计的软件,擅长于原理图绘制和PCB布局布线,而非专注于单片机系统的设计与仿真。仿真能力限制:虽然Protel99SE包含一定的仿真功能,但其仿真模块相对简单,并不能全面支持各种单片机的复杂设计与仿真需求。

它的发展与仿真应用、算法、计算机和建模等技术的发展相辅相成。1984年出现了第一个以数据库为核心的仿真软件系统,此后又出现采用人工智能技术(专家系统)的仿真软件系统。这个发展趋势将使仿真软件具有更强、更灵活的功能、能面向更广泛的用户。

keiluvision4安装汉化及破解图文详细教程附下载

1、安装教程 在本站下载好软件压缩包单片机内置页面设计软件,将其解压后双击运行里面的“MDK41exe”单片机内置页面设计软件,点击“next”,开始安装软件。勾选“i agree...”,接受许可协议。选择安装目录。填写注册名、注册公司等信息。开始安装软件,稍微等一会。安装完成,默认就好,不用去修改,点击“finish”。

2、首先,前往Keil4安装文件夹,找到并双击Keil uVisionexe启动安装。接着,点击“Next”按钮,阅读并同意许可协议。选择合适的安装路径,避免安装在系统盘以确保系统稳定性,同时确保路径内无中文或特殊字符,以避免后续使用时出现错误。输入个人信息时,可随意填写,以保护个人隐私。

3、启动Keil uVision4的安装程序,可以通过点击“MDK41exe”来实现。安装过程中,系统会弹出一个协议确认窗口,用户需要勾选“i agree...”这一项,表明同意协议内容。这项内容用户并不需要细看,自行选择即可点击“next”。用户可以选择安装路径,如果需要,可以选择改变默认的C盘安装位置。

4、下载安装:首先,从可靠来源下载Keil uVision4的安装包,通常该安装包会包含Keil C51 V900等组件。解压安装包,并找到Keil C51 V900的安装程序进行安装。注册与激活:安装完成后,打开Keil uVision4。在软件界面右上角找到CID,并将其复制下来。打开安装包中的KEIL_Lic工具。

加速度传感器怎么用proteus仿真

在进行Proteus中的加速度传感器仿真时,首要步骤是优化图纸。首先,右键点击并删除器件箱中不必要的元件,接着选择编辑功能中的整理选项并确认,这将移除图纸上无物理连接和超出工作区域的元件。以Proteus 5为例,模拟光敏电阻的步骤如下:启动Proteus软件,打开界面。

这个很正常,Proteus只有最基本的元器件,诸如传感器,模块什么是不提供的。要仿真也有办法,要研究一下传感器的特征。比如电阻型的传感器(热敏电阻之类)就用相应阻值的一个电位器代替;比如输出数字量的传感器就以拨码开关之类的代替,直接向单片机输出数字量。

stm32f103c6。三轴陀螺仪里面的三轴即X轴、Y轴、Z轴。三个轴围成的立体空间联合检测手机的各种动作,陀螺仪最主要的作用在于可以测量角速度。

式中:[M]为质量矩阵;[C]为阻尼矩阵;[K]为刚度矩阵;()为节点加速度向量()为节点速度向量;(U)为节点位移向量。在任意给定的时间t,这些方程可以看作是一系列考虑了惯性力和阻尼力的静力学平衡方程。ANSYS程序使用Newmark的时间积分方法在离散点上求解这些方程。

如何学习嵌入式或单片机的gui?

1、学习嵌入式或单片机的GUI,可以先从现学现用开始,利用搭配的模拟器进行初步单片机内置页面设计软件了解和实践。LVGL是一个值得推荐的GUI库,其PC模拟器提供了一定便利,让单片机内置页面设计软件你在没有实际硬件的情况下也能学习和设计GUI界面。

单片机内置页面设计软件(单片机做界面)

2、主要编程语言单片机内置页面设计软件:C语言单片机内置页面设计软件:由于其良好的移置性和底层开发的特性,C语言是嵌入式GUI开发中的主流语言。C语言能够直接操作硬件,适合底层和驱动层的开发。C++语言:C++作为C语言的升级,向下兼容C语言,并且提供了更多的功能和特性,如面向对象编程等。

3、听录音时,每天应先听前一天所学内容,如昨天学过的单词,重复记忆有利于巩固所学内容。你可以快速重复内容,不需要花很长时间,然后再听新内容。如此循环往复,循序渐进,既增加了学习兴趣,又能及时有效地检查学习结果。 要持之以恒。

4、学习嵌入式方向需要掌握以下课程:C语言:基础要求:掌握C语言,精通更佳,这是嵌入式开发的基础。操作系统原理与硬件原理:深入理解:学习操作系统原理,了解硬件的基本构造和工作原理。硬件及接口技术:掌握硬件接口知识,这是与硬件进行交互的基础。

5、首先,单片机也是嵌入式的一个分支,所以不能将之分离开来。一般而言,嵌入式学习的进阶过程为:学习单片机作为入门知识,不管是51单片机,还是AVR、PIC等系列单片机都可以作为入门知识来学习。有一定单片机基础之后,可以向两个方向深入。对于嵌入式,应该掌握以下点:打好C语言基础。